
The Vel Maral Maha Mantram is a powerful devotional hymn dedicated to Lord Murugan, specifically invoking the protection and strength of his divine spear, the Vel. It is a rearranged form of the "Vel Vaguppu" verses from the Thiruppugazh, originally composed by the saint Arunagirinathar. Origin and Purpose Compilation: The current format was compiled by Vallimalai Sri Sachidananda Swamigal.Significance: It is considered a "Maha Mantram" because of its perceived ability to remove negative energies, fear, and physical or mental ailments. Benefits: Devotees recite it to seek victory over internal and external enemies, spiritual protection, and overall well-being.The "Maral" Method. The term "Maral" refers to the unique, complex structure of the recitation: The original 16 verses are rearranged and repeated in a specific sequence—forward, backwards, ascending, and descending.
